What is Augmentin?
Augmentin has active ingredients of amoxicillin; clavulanate potassium. It is often used in sinusitis. eHealthMe is studying from 42,620 Augmentin users. Check the latest studies of Augmentin.
What is Kadian?
Kadian has active ingredients of morphine sulfate. It is often used in pain. eHealthMe is studying from 23,045 Kadian users. Check the latest studies of Kadian.

How the study uses the data?
The study uses data from the FDA. It is based on amoxicillin; clavulanate potassium and morphine sulfate (the active ingredients of Augmentin and Kadian, respectively), and Augmentin and Kadian (the brand names). Other drugs that have the same active ingredients (e.g. generic drugs) are not considered. Dosage of drugs is not considered in the study.
